Why Lake Lanier?
Lake Lanier is more than just a body of water?it's a vibrant community. With over 38,000 acres of water and nearly 700 miles of shoreline, the lake attracts a variety of homebuyers, from retirees searching for a peaceful lifestyle to young families eager for outdoor activities. The proximity to Atlanta also makes it a prime location for those seeking a retreat without relinquishing urban amenities. The desirability of Lake Lanier real estate is thus rooted in its unique combination of natural beauty and strategic location.

Current Market Insights
The real estate market around Lake Lanier has seen significant shifts, reflective of broader national trends. Increasingly, people are prioritizing homes that provide space, both inside and out. This trend has led to a heightened demand for lakefront properties with private docks, expansive views, and outdoor living spaces. Sellers currently have a strategic advantage, but pricing competitively is still crucial as buyers have become more discerning.

Purchasers are advised to enter the market with a clear understanding of their priorities. While the allure of a waterfront property is strong, factors such as proximity to amenities, property taxes, and potential maintenance costs must be considered. Partnering with knowledgeable professionals can make a significant difference in navigating these complexities.

Timeless Tips for Buyers and Sellers
1. For Buyers: Conduct a thorough inspection. Waterfront properties require specific attention to docks, seawalls, and potential water damage. Consulting local experts familiar with Lake Lanier can provide insights that a general inspector might miss.

2. For Sellers: Present your property at its best. Staging the home with its natural surroundings in mind, highlighting waterfront views, and investing in minor renovations can substantially boost buyer interest.
